I am have a lot of hair loss.
If I comb my hair tie it up there is a lot of breakage and hairfall. The volume has become very less from earlier I can find a lot while washing and all over the house as well please suggest what I can do to at least stop it and then maybe new growth

Hair loss from the hairline or crown can occur due to many reasons, more commonly due to- - hormonal effect - nutrition  - lifestyle imbalance - stress - Medical conditions, fever The exact reason can be found out by taking detailed history and hair analysis .  Accordingly, anti hairloss medicines, hair specific multivitamins, lotions and gels are prescribed. Many non surgical external treatments are available that show good results and can prevent hair transplant. These are : Mesoporation with hair peptides Stemcell, Dermaroller PRP therapy etc.  Treatments are prescribed according to diagnosis. You can expect results in 6 to 8 months with a combination of these treatments.

Hairfall is not due to one single cause. There are many conditions which can cause extreme hair loss and thinning of hair on the scalp. So first and foremost we have to find the cause of hair fall with the help of detailed history and examination. Some of the common causes maybe nutritional deficiency, hormonal causes like androgenic alopecia also called pattern baldness, hypothyroidism, telogeun effluvium etc. Unless we find and c,read the cause there is no point in giving non specific treatment. Also one should refrain from home remedies as it does not give any relief from hairfall. A sudden onset of Hairfall in excess can be because of a reduction in the length of hair cycle. This is a response to stress. It could be because of some underlying health issue that has not been taken care of. But in most cases it can be just a manifestation of physical and mental stress. Get yourself fitter by following healthy leisure habits. Sleep early, have direct sunlight early morning and eat at the right times. Have wholesome meals. Hope this helps...
